Read the comment:
/** Navigation links for the user sidebar.
* 'text' is the name of the MediaWiki message that contains the label of
this link
* 'href' is the name of the MediaWiki message that contains the link target
of this link.
* Link targets starting with http are considered remote links. Ones not
starting with
* http are considered as names of local wiki pages.
*/
Use this:
$wgNavigationLinks = array (
array( 'text'=>'mainpage', 'href'=>'mainpage' ),
array( 'text'=>'recentchanges',
'href'=>'recentchanges-url' ),
array( 'text'=>'randompage',
'href'=>'randompage-url' ),
array( 'text'=>'allpages', 'href'=>'allpages-url'
),
array( 'text'=>'categories', 'href'=>'allpages-url'
),
);
Now, go to the page MediaWiki:allpages-url, at your site, and place the url,
like: Special:Allpages
As you can see, the text of the link and the href is stored at a system
message.
